The 80-ball game could be seen as having been less popular than the 75 and 90-ball games but with sites such as Gala , The Sun and Jackpotjoy supporting this alternative you're more likely than ever to come across it.

Stating the obvious, the 80-ball bingo game sits nicely in between the two other versions but is played on a four by four card. When playing 80-ball bingo there are new ways to win such as the four corners game. With extra numbers available there are also new patterns to bingo on depending on what site you play with.

Each of the above sites supports a different way to play and has different terminology for 80 ball games, but don't let this deter you. Whether you play on just one site or across a few, the 80-ball experience is unlike those more commonly played and so is well worth learning a few simple pointers.

With the issue of fair games featuring in our forum this week, we’ve been investigating what measures online bingo sites have in place to make sure players get a fair game every time.

A game of chance?

Unlike in a game of live bingo, online bingo players are not able to see the numbers being drawn and have to trust in the site’s bingo software to run smoothly and fairly. There are numerous was in which your favourite site can ensure that all players get an equal chance to win including the use of random number generators. These are used for most online gambling games and provide the unpredictability that games such as online bingo rely on. Unlike betting on a horse, where a number of factors can influence the outcome of a race, playing a game of online bingo is entirely a game of chance and depends – unpredictability is an essential part of the fun.
